What's Happening?
Travel experts are advising that the best time to book flights to Europe is during the week of Thanksgiving. According to Katy Nastro, a travel expert and spokesperson for Going, this period is historically the most cost-effective for international travel, particularly to Western European destinations like Spain and Portugal. Nastro notes that while flights for Christmas and New Year’s are seeing price increases, Thanksgiving week remains a bargain due to lower demand for international travel. For example, a round-trip flight from New York City to Barcelona can be found for as low as $304, which is approximately 60% off the average price. The optimal time to book these flights is 35 days before departure, with the best deals typically available in October.
